Examine Door Seals
Three simple actions can assist you guarantee your home appliance's door seals remain in good problem. First, inspect the seals consistently for any type of splits, splits, or indications of wear. These damages can cause air leaks, impacting effectiveness. Second, tidy the seals utilizing warm, soapy water to get rid of any kind of particles or crud. A clean seal assures a tight fit and far better performance. Lastly, carry out a straightforward examination by shutting the door on a notepad. If you can conveniently pull it out without resistance, the seal might require replacing. By adhering to these steps, you'll maintain your home appliance's efficiency and long life, saving you money on energy costs and repair work in the lengthy run.
Display Temperature Setups
Frequently monitoring your home appliance's temperature settings is essential for finest efficiency and performance. Whether you're dealing with a fridge, fridge freezer, or stove, watching on these settings can prevent several concerns. For refrigerators, go for temperature levels between 35 ° F and 38 ° F; for fridges freezer, stay 0 ° F. If the temperature levels are also high or reduced, your appliance may function harder, squandering power and reducing its life expectancy. Make use of a thermometer to check these setups regularly, especially after significant changes, like relocating your home appliance or adjusting the thermostat. If you see variations, change the setups accordingly and get in touch with the individual handbook for advice. By remaining proactive about temperature surveillance, you'll guarantee your appliances run efficiently and last much longer.
Repairing Cooling Concerns
When your fridge isn't cooling appropriately, it can result in spoiled food and threw away cash, so attending to the problem without delay is essential. Start by checking the temperature setups to verify they go to the recommended levels, normally around 37 ° F for the refrigerator and 0 ° F for the freezer. If the settings are proper, check the door seals for any kind of gaps or damage; a faulty seal can enable warm air to get in.
Following, analyze the vents inside the fridge and freezer. Verify they're not obstructed by food things, as this can interrupt air movement. Listen for the compressor; if it's not running or making uncommon sounds, it might need interest. Examine the condenser coils, typically located at the back or base of the unit. Dust and debris can accumulate, causing cooling concerns. Tidy them with a vacuum cleaner or brush to maximize efficiency. If troubles persist, it may be time to call an expert.

Identify Leak Sources
How can you efficiently identify the sources of water leakage and ice accumulation in your devices? Begin by inspecting the seals and gaskets on your fridge and fridge freezer doors. A used or damaged seal can allow warm air to enter, creating condensation and ice. Next, inspect the drain pan and drain system for obstructions or clogs; a backed-up drainpipe can lead to water merging. Search for any type of loose links in the water system line, which can create leaks. Likewise, examine the defrost drain for ice buildup, which could disrupt appropriate water drainage. By methodically checking these areas, you'll pinpoint the resource of the problem, enabling you to take the needed steps to repair it and expand your device's life-span.

Frequently Asked Concerns
How Typically Should I Clean the Fridge Coils?
You ought to cleanse your fridge coils every six months. This aids maintain efficiency and stops getting too hot. If you observe extreme dirt or pet hair, tidy them extra often to assure your refrigerator runs smoothly.

What Temperature level Should My Fridge Be Establish To?
You must set your refrigerator to 37 ° F(3 ° C) for excellent food conservation. This temperature level maintains your food fresh while protecting against perishing, guaranteeing your grocery stores last much longer and lowering waste. It's a very easy change you can make!
Does a Fridge Need to Be Leveled?
Yes, your fridge requires to be leveled. If it's uneven, it can impact cooling effectiveness and create excess sound. Inspect the leveling legs and adjust them to assure correct equilibrium for excellent efficiency.
Exactly How Can I Decrease Fridge Power Intake?
To lower your fridge's energy intake, keep it clean and well-ventilated, inspect door seals for leaks, set the temperature level in between 35-38 ° F, and avoid overloading it. These actions can considerably decrease your energy bills.
